    The 200 doesn’t have a rat tail. Varusteleka confirmed that the tang is “full” underneath the handle, as in that the tang is the same as the bare tang version underneath the rubber.

    • @Murtagh653
      @Murtagh653 ปีที่แล้ว

      if it's the same as the blade blank that they also sell (which allows you to make your own handle), the tang is not actually a full tang, but it is skeletonized, so almost full, but weaker than a proper full tang.

    • @allemander
      @allemander 3 ปีที่แล้ว +2

      Ricasso - definition of ricasso by The Free Dictionary
      An unsharpened section of a sword or knife blade next to the hilt.
